About the role
Vantage Compute is seeking a highly skilled Senior Network Engineer to lead the implementation and delivery of a multi-phase network transformation initiative . This role is responsible for executing against a defined Statement of Work, including design validation, staging, migration, integration, and cutover activities for a next-generation network architecture. The ideal candidate is hands-on, detail-oriented, and experienced in data center networking, routing, security, and large-scale migrations , with the ability to drive execution while maintaining alignment with architectural standards. Key Responsibilities Execute delivery of a multi-phase Network 2.0 transformation , including design validation, staging, migration, integration, and service cutover Implement and support Arista-based data center fabric architectures , including EVPN/VXLAN, MLAG, and BGP-based designs Configure and integrate Palo Alto firewalls , including NAT migration, policy design, and Panorama management Support datacenter consolidation and interconnect design , including redundant circuits and VPN failover strategies Deploy and validate core, edge, and management network components aligned to defined architecture standards Implement: eBGP/iBGP routing at the edge OSPF underlay with MP-BGP EVPN overlay VRF segmentation across multiple security zones Lead staging and proof-of-concept validation , including failover testing, interoperability, and performance validation Migrate legacy configurations (e.g., Juniper) into new Arista and Palo Alto environments Execute phased integration and cutover activities with minimal service disruption Develop and execute service migration plans , including rollback strategies and validation procedures Perform post-cutover validation , ensuring routing convergence, security enforcement, and service availability Collaborate with client and ISP teams to coordinate change windows and integration activities Produce and maintain detailed technical documentation, runbooks, and validation reports Required Qualifications 5–8+ years of experience in enterprise networking and infrastructure implementation Strong hands-on expertise with: Arista EOS (EVPN/VXLAN, MLAG, BGP) Palo Alto firewalls (policy, NAT, Panorama) Deep understanding of: Routing protocols (BGP, OSPF) Data center networking and segmentation (VRFs, VLANs) High availability design (ECMP, BFD, clustering) Experience with network migrations, cutovers, and large-scale infrastructure transitions Ability to translate architecture into real-world configurations and execution plans Strong troubleshooting and validation skills across routing, security, and connectivity layers Experience working in client-facing or professional services environments Originally posted on Himalayas
